The St. Thomas Learning Center

Offering “Quality tutoring at an affordable cost”, the St. Thomas Learning Center, under the direction of St. Thomas Episcopal Church and in cooperation with Baldwin-Wallace College, will provide focused instruction in the area(s) most needed by the student including mathematics, language arts, science and social studies. 

The tutors will be junior and senior Baldwin-Wallace college students from the Division of Education or specially selected B-W students, chosen for their expertise in their academic area.

Tutoring sessions are:

  1. one hour in length
  2. held at St. Thomas Episcopal Church, 50 E. Bagley Road, Berea, Ohio
  3. Held on Mondays or Tuesdays from 4: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m. during the college calendar year
  4. supervised by an adult from St. Thomas
  5. $20 per hour with a minimum of four one-hour sessions
  6. Due to begin in October, 2010, and operate throughout the academic year
  7. Designed  for students in grades 6-12
